ALEXANDRIA, Va.–NCUA’s Office of Consumer Financial Protection said it is partnering with the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) to host a webinar focused on how credit unions and their members can prepare for, and remain resilient in the face of, climate-related disasters.

NEW YORK–Citigroup has announced a small reduction in its mortgage workforce, due to what it called an internal streamlining of functions. The cutbacks come as the overall mortgage lending market has slowed down due to rising rates.

ARLINGTON, Va. – National Consumer Cooperative Bank, the holding company of National Cooperative Bank, (NCB), has announced the issuance of a $58.5 million patronage refund to 1,685 cooperative stockholders nationwide, including $12.9 million in cash. 

ALEXANDRIA, Va.–CUToday.info’s latest review of disclosure forms filed by nine credit unions seeking to merge has found two CUs, both of which posted losses over the first six months, seeking to combine; several CUs with capital north of 22% again not distributing any of that net worth to members; just one acquiring CU of more than a billion in assets (a rarity), and one small CU that still operates out of a person’s home and which does business by phone only.
